Uniting and Healing campaign to hold Men’s March Saturday
ROCHESTER, N.Y. (WHEC) — Uniting and Healing Through Hope of Monroe County is continuing to hold events in its push to end violence in Rochester.
The campaign is holding a men’s march on Saturday, followed by a family cookout and concert.
Organizer Clay Harris said he believes young boys need to know and learn from their fathers, to not spread violence in their community.
"We have a lot of different speakers who are going to speak to the men, and the young men and the boys about what it is to be a man, to be a young man and to grow up and be a productive citizen and how to get involved to stop this violence," Harris said.
Presumptive mayor-elect Malik Evans will be one of those speakers.

The event will be held at the Ark of Covenant Church at 60 Lorimer St. in Rochester
Breakfast will be served from 8 a.m. to 9 a.m. and the workshop and seminar will take place afterward from 9 a.m. to noon. The march will be from noon to 1 p.m. and the family cookout and concert will be from 2 p.m. to 7 p.m. at Jones Park, across the street from the church.
